William Doyle Because of a Dream Lyrics Meaning
"Because of a Dream" explores the idea of the profound impact dreams can have on our perceptions of reality. The lyrics suggest that the dreamer's absence from a situation is due to being engrossed in a dream where they feel liberated and detached from their physical existence. The dream is described as a surreal experience of flying and transcending physical boundaries. The song reflects on the illusory nature of reality and the idea that nothing is inherently sacred or real. Ultimately, it prompts listeners to contemplate the significance of dreams and the fluidity of existence, questioning the concept of truth and the nature of reality itself.

William Doyle, originally known by his stage name East India Youth, is an English musician hailing from Bournemouth, England.
William Doyle has a diverse musical background, having released his first solo album, "Born in the USB," in 2009. He was also the leader of the indie pop group Doyle and the Fourfathers, which released their only studio album, "Man Made," in 2011.
William Doyle was born on January 29, 1991, in Bournemouth, United Kingdom. As of now, he is 33 years old.
William Doyle is associated with the alternative/indie music genre, known for his experimental and eclectic musical style.
